Yeah, these chapters are great, but there's one verse in 2 Nephi 9 where it talks about the keeper of the gate is the Holy One of Israel.
He employeth no servant there, and he cannot be deceived.
And President James E. Faust, I hope people remember President Faust, gave this great story.
In fact, they made a movie about it even. And he talked about a friend whose husband was going to medical school. And he said, this is from the friend, getting into medical school is pretty
competitive. The desire to do well and be successful puts a great deal of pressure on new incoming freshmen. So this friend of President Faust said, my husband worked hard
in his studies and went to attend his first exam. The honor system was expected behavior at the
medical school, but the professor passed out the exam and left the room. Within a short time,
students started to pull little cheat papers out from under their papers or from their pockets.
My husband recalled his heart beginning to pound as he realized it's pretty hard to compete against cheaters.
This is so good.
About that time, a tall, lanky student stood up in the back of the room and said,
I left my hometown, put my wife and three little babies in an upstairs apartment,
and worked very hard to get into medical school.
And I'll turn in the first one of you who cheats and you better believe it.
President Faust said they believed it.
There were many sheepish expressions and those cheap papers started to disappear as fast as they had appeared.
He set a standard for the class, which eventually graduated the largest group in the school's history.
The young, lanky medical student who challenged the cheaters was J. Ballard Washburn, who became a respected physician and in later years received special recognition from the Utah Medical Association.
He also served as a general authority and is now the president, when his talk was given, of the Las Vegas Nevada Temple.
What a great story, he said. In reality, of the Las Vegas, Nevada temple. What a great story.
He said, in reality, we're only in competition with ourselves.
And we've got to be honest with ourselves.
We may deceive others, but we can't deceive the Lord.
